shibing624/agentica

Agentica: Lightweight async-first Python framework for AI agents. 轻量级异步优先的AI Agent框架,支持工具调用、RAG、多智能体和MCP。

63
/ 100
Established

Provides 40+ built-in tools (search, code execution, file operations, OCR, image generation) and supports multiple agent patterns including Teams for dynamic delegation and Workflows for deterministic orchestration. Built on async-first primitives enabling parallel tool execution via `asyncio.gather()`, with integrations for LangChain/LlamaIndex RAG, MCP protocol support across stdio/SSE/HTTP transports, and a Markdown-based Skill system for model-agnostic capability injection.

251 stars and 462 monthly downloads. Available on PyPI.

Maintenance 13 / 25
Adoption 16 / 25
Maturity 18 / 25
Community 16 / 25

How are scores calculated?

Stars

251

Forks

31

Language

Python

License

Apache-2.0

Last pushed

Mar 09, 2026

Monthly downloads

462

Commits (30d)

0

Dependencies

19

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/agents/shibing624/agentica"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.